Nevada King’s Silver Park Discovery Sparks District-Scale Potential for Atlanta-Style Gold
Nevada King Gold Corp. (TSXV: NKG; OTCQB: NKGFF) has unveiled a pivotal discovery at its Silver Park target within the Atlanta Gold Mine Project in Nevada’s Battle Mountain Trend, marking a critical expansion of its high-grade oxide gold system. A Phase III drill program returned an intercept of 1.11 g/t AuEq over 25 meters, a significant result that aligns with the geological continuity of the Atlanta-style mineralization—a hallmark of the region’s Carlin-type gold deposits. This discovery underscores the project’s district-scale potential, with the company now targeting multiple new zones to build upon its existing 1.1 million-ounce resource base.
Geological Continuity: Bridging Silver Park and Atlanta
The Silver Park intercept, drilled 2 km northeast of the Atlanta Resource Zone, occurs within the Silver Park Rhyodacite unit, a geological formation chemically and structurally analogous to the Atlanta Rhyodacite intrusive dome. This shared host rock provides a critical link to the Atlanta-style mineralization, which is characterized by gold enrichment along Tertiary-Paleozoic unconformities and rhyodacite intrusive complexes. Cross-sections (e.g., Figure R26) reveal that both zones lie along the same basement structural framework, suggesting a unified gold system extending across 3 km of strike length at Silver Park.
Geophysical surveys (CSAMT and gravity) have further defined hidden intrusive bodies beneath post-mineral volcanic cover, particularly northwest of the current drill area. Nevada King plans to test these targets in summer 2025, with drilling aimed at expanding the mineralized envelope into underexplored sectors.
Metallurgical and Processing Viability
Metallurgical testing of 986 samples from the Atlanta district has confirmed a robust 86.7% average gold cyanide solubility, a key metric for conventional oxide processing. This bodes well for the Silver Park discovery, as the intercept’s oxide gold content likely aligns with the project’s existing metallurgical profile. Past highlights, such as a 9.9 g/t Au over 27.4m intercept in 2024, further validate the district’s potential for high-grade oxide gold deposits, which are typically lower-cost to mine and process than sulfide deposits.
